The JEN SX1000 reimagined
SX1000 is a faithful emulation of the JEN SX1000, a vintage Italian synthesizer released in 1978 and one of the first affordable analog instruments widely available in Europe. Designed for musicians who wanted hands on control without prohibitive costs, it played a key role in bringing analog synthesis to a broader audience.
At its core, SX1000 recreates the original monophonic architecture and the sound of the M110 chip, while carefully expanding the instrument beyond its historical limitations. Additions such as a full polyphonic mode, a sub oscillator reaching down to minus three octaves, extended legato and velocity controls, a classic arpeggiator, and four flexible effects open up a much wider sonic range, without losing the distinctive organic character of the original.

Features
-
Faithful emulation of the JEN SX1000 and its M110 chip
-
Monophonic analog architecture with optional full polyphonic mode
-
Single oscillator with sawtooth square and pulse waveforms
-
Sub oscillator with range down to minus three octaves
-
White and pink noise generator with optional MM5837 emulation
-
24 dB per octave resonant low pass filter with self oscillation
-
One LFO expanded with additional waveforms and sync mode
-
Two ADSR envelopes for volume and filter
-
Extended legato modes with velocity support
-
Arpeggiator inspired by a classic analog polysynth with multiple modes and sync
-
Four integrated effects including tape echo spring reverb wave folder and flanger
-
Flexible drag and drop effect routing
-
Oversampling for improved audio quality
-
Resizable window with brightness and contrast controls
-
Preset system with randomizer
